Snowpack

HS was 30-70cm. 10-30cm of 2-4mm facets sits near the ground with 4f to 1f slab over top. An inconsistent, weak pencil minus crust sits just above the facets in places. We had one notable three meter whumpf on a north-facing knoll that collapsed the whole feature. Test results were ECTP(11) x2 on the top of the facets above the ground. Surface cracks propagated down to this layer as well. There is a crust on the surface of steep east and southeast-facing terrain up to 11,000ft.

Avalanche

Two old slabs were visible from across the creek on north and northeast aspects. Suspect they ran during the storm on 12/29.
